Output 5399d18bce3f80a97052303fc109423f96d842c63ba0e8caecd12a2869368114:10

value
43313347
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d7cfe0a85dd6a766b07827abafee408d81f1599b OP_EQUALVERIFY OP_CHECKSIG
address
1Lg7Jq9yBY5PzishMB64usEVdt6jdKsGwR
transaction
5399d18bce3f80a97052303fc109423f96d842c63ba0e8caecd12a2869368114
spent
true